Episiotomy, Past and Present
In the past, episiotomy was frequently performed during vaginal birth to minimize the risk of severe perineal tearing. This surgical procedure involved making a deliberate incision in the perineum, the area between the vagina and anus, to alleviate pressure during the final stages of delivery. What is Cellulitis?
Cellulitis is a common bacterial infection that affects the deeper tissues of the skin. Primarily caused by staphylococcus or streptococcus bacteria, although other strains can also be responsible, it is important to recognize its warning signs to ensure prompt treatment and prevent the condition from becoming life-threatening.
